Solutions for Whiplash
Whiplash, also called neck sprain or neck strain, is an injury to the soft tissues of the neck. It's usually caused by sudden extension (backward movement of the neck) and flexion (forward movement of the neck). This type of injury is often the result of rear-end car crashes. Severe whiplash can also include injury to the intervertebral joints, discs, ligaments, cervical muscles and nerve roots.
